Elected by the shareholders, the Ouster Common's board of directors comprises two types of representatives: Ouster Common inside directors who are chosen from within the company, and outside directors, selected externally and held independent of Ouster. The board's role is to monitor Ouster Common's management team and ensure that shareholders' interests are well served. Ouster Common's inside directors are responsible for reviewing and approving budgets prepared by upper management to implement core corporate initiatives and projects. On the other hand, Ouster Common's outside directors are responsible for providing unbiased perspectives on the board's policies.
